1 definition by Justmillerlo

A stunning beautiful woman that is full of clever quips. She is always daintily walks as if she’s walking on clouds. Although she has no concept of time- she doesn’t need it because she always arrives like a princess. Her secret/not so secret love of all time is Prince. She makes the best friend because she always has a revenge plan up her sleeve whilst appearing guilt free with her most innocent looking eyes. Equipped with all the Disney songs- she’ll be your best cheerleader. You’ll know you have met a Salam because she is unforgettable.
“Whooooah Bro- did you see that girl Salam?!? She’s so nerdy hot!”
by Justmillerlo November 26, 2021
Get the Salam mug.